In the realm of DNA testing, paternity tests are undoubtedly one of the most common uses. This type of test is typically used to determine a biological relationship between a father and child. However, what happens when the alleged father is not available for testing? In such cases, scientists have developed another method known as a “paternity test through siblings.”

Paternity tests through siblings involve analyzing the DNA of siblings to determine the likelihood of a biological relationship with a potential father. While this method may not offer the same level of accuracy as traditional paternity testing, it can still provide valuable insights into familial relationships and help resolve questions surrounding paternity.

One of the primary reasons why paternity tests through siblings are conducted is when the alleged father is deceased or unavailable for testing. In such cases, siblings of the alleged father can provide valuable genetic information that can be used to infer paternity. By comparing DNA markers between siblings and a child, scientists can calculate the probability of a biological relationship between the child and the alleged father.

Another scenario where paternity tests through siblings may be necessary is when the alleged father is unwilling to participate in testing. In cases of paternity disputes or legal proceedings, a court may order siblings of the alleged father to undergo testing to establish paternity. While this method may not be as definitive as traditional paternity testing, it can still provide substantial evidence to support or refute a biological relationship.

The process of conducting a paternity test through siblings involves collecting DNA samples from the siblings of the alleged father and the child in question. These samples are then analyzed to identify genetic markers that are shared between siblings and the child. By comparing these markers, scientists can determine the likelihood of a biological relationship between the child and the alleged father.

It is important to note that the accuracy of paternity tests through siblings may vary depending on the number of siblings available for testing and the genetic information they share with the child. In cases where multiple siblings are available for testing and they share a significant amount of genetic material with the child, the results of the test are likely to be more reliable.
